MicroStrategy (NASDAQ:MSTR) Hits New 1-Year High After Analyst Upgrade

MicroStrategy Incorporated (NASDAQ:MSTRGet Free Report)’s share price reached a new 52-week high during trading on Monday after Barclays raised their price target on the stock from $173.00 to $225.00. Barclays currently has an overweight rating on the stock. MicroStrategy traded as high as $225.55 and last traded at $225.55, with a volume of 1468093 shares changing hands. The stock had previously closed at $212.59.

MicroStrategy (NASDAQ:MSTRG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, August 1st. The software maker reported ($0.57) E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of ($0.09) by ($0.48). MicroStrategy had a negative return on equity of 14.72% and a negative net margin of 43.69%. The company had revenue of $111.44 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$121.99 million.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business posted $0.15 EPS. The company’s revenue was down 7.4% on a year-over-year basis.

MicroStrategy Incorporated provides artificial intelligence-powered enterprise analytics software and services in the United States,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, and internationally. It offers MicroStrategy ONE, which provides non-technical users with the ability to directly access novel and actionable insights for decision-making; and MicroStrategy Cloud for Government service, which offers always-on threat monitoring that meets the rigorous technical and regulatory needs of governments and financial institutions.
